Assessing Legal Professional Expenses: What You Ought to Learn
How can individuals guarantee they are making informed decisions when assessing attorney fees? Understanding the fee structure is essential. Attorneys may bill hourly rates, flat fees, or retainer fees, each with distinct implications for the total cost. Individuals should inquire about what services are included in the fee and whether additional costs,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, may occur.
Evaluating fees from numerous attorneys is important, but the lowest price may not always indicate the most worthwhile investment. It's necessary to factor in the attorney's experience, reputation, and success rate alongside their fees. Additionally, individuals should explore flexible payment options or financing options to alleviate economic hardship. Clarity is key; a well-regarded attorney will provide a clear breakdown of pricing and answer questions without hesitation. Ultimately, well-researched choices come from careful copyrightination and open communication regarding fees and services rendered.

Commonly Posed Questions
What timeframe can you usually anticipate from the procedure?
Immigration applications typically take anywhere from several months to several years, contingent upon various factors including the petition type, country of residence, and present processing times at immigration departments.
What Are the Potential Hazards of Addressing Immigration Issues Without an Legal Representative?
Handling immigration matters without an attorney can result in confusion, postponements, and possible denials. People may overlook critical deadlines, miss required documentation, or misunderstand laws, eventually compromising their chances of obtaining favorable results.
May I Change Immigration Legal Representatives During My Legal Proceeding?
Yes, people can change immigration attorneys mid-case. However, it's critical to copyrightine potential disruptions and postponements in the procedure. Proper communication and documentation are essential to ensure an efficient changeover between counsel.
What ought to I take action if My Request Is Denied?
When an application gets rejected, the individual should closely copyrightine the rejection letter, pinpoint the grounds for denial, gather necessary documentation, and explore resubmitting or challenging the ruling within the designated deadline to improve chances of success.
How Do I Make Preparations for My Attorney's Session?
To get ready for an legal professional's consultation, an individual should collect pertinent documents, list important inquiries, and note important details about their case. This preparation enhances communication and guarantees a productive discussion about immigration matters.
